What is the Austrian Driver's License?

The Austrian driver's license (Führerschein) is an official document provided by the government that permits people to run automobile on public roadways. The license varies depending upon the type of car that a person is permitted to drive. This document is recognized throughout EU member states, making it particularly valuable for both citizens and travelers.

Types of Austrian Driver's Licenses

Austrian driver's licenses cover numerous classifications based on the kind of cars a person is licensed to drive. Below is a list of the prevalent categories:

License CategoryDescriptionMinimum Age
A1Bikes as much as 125cc16
AAll motorbikes24 (20 with additional training)
BVehicles and vans up to 3.5 heaps17
CTrucks over 3.5 heaps21
DBuses24
ETrailers over 750 kgVaries

Costs Involved

The costs for obtaining a driver's license in Austria can differ depending on the area and particular driving school. Below is an approximated breakdown of costs:

ExpenseEstimated Cost (EUR)
Medical Examination50 - 150
Vision Test20 - 50
Driving School Course1,500 - 2,500
Theoretical Exam Fee30 - 50
Practical Exam Fee50 - 100
License Issuance Fee30 - 60
Overall Estimated Cost1,710 - 2,910
